Output e15894c39ec4a99bd17eb0dcc32b438ee1aadf5be6c20259fdceb989d52d2f13:0

value
851463
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4679815f6396219597f82d04e9bde3fe72c71af0 OP_EQUAL
address
387enK5FAs2ejPqZCLjjp1N1tCig3eorSE
transaction
e15894c39ec4a99bd17eb0dcc32b438ee1aadf5be6c20259fdceb989d52d2f13
spent
true